 Term 2 Connected Learning 

This term, our learning focuses on 'Where would you settle?'. Our key text in English is The Lost Happy Endings, which is based on traditional fairytales and focuses on adding description and figurative language to add imagery to our writing and develop the character and settings.  Our science learning this term focuses on properties and changes of materials, looking at how we can describe materials based on their properties, how materials can be changed and if changes are reversible or irreversible. Our Geography topic this term is settlements looking at different types of classification of settlements and using OS maps and aerial photos to identify types of settlement and features they have. In History we look at the Anglo-Saxon period of Britain and understand why they came and how they ruled across the kingdom.  In Art the term is ‘Dreamscapes’. Using illustrations from Craig Russell and Lorenzo Mattotti and the Surrealism movement, children will practice drawing techniques to create their own dreamscape. In RE we look at the question 'Was Jesus the Messiah?' looking at what was prophesied in the Bible and making links to Incarnation.
